Are you talking about tabs on the tab bar?
When do these tabs appear?
Can't you close the with a middle-click or via the right-click context menu on the tab bar?

If they open when you click the Home button then see:


If they open when you start Firefox as part of session restore then you can check for problems with the sessionstore.js and sessionstore.bak files in the Firefox Profile Folder that store session data.

Delete the sessionstore.js file and possible sessionstore-##.js files with a number and sessionstore.bak in the Firefox Profile Folder.

Deleting sessionstore.js will cause App Tabs and Tab Groups and open and closed (undo) tabs to get lost, so you will have to create them again (make a note or bookmark them).

Have a look on the Options menu, in the General tab.

Are the reappearing tabs listed in Homepage? [You may have to click inside the text-box and scroll to the right to see them all.] If so, they will reappear every time you start a new session. You need to carefully delete the ones you don't want.

[Some websites put up "Do you want to make this page your homepage?" lines. You or someone else in the household may have accidentally clicked Yes. Some addons also annoying add themselves to your homepages, if you're not careful.]
